Colony Documentary Directed by Ross McDonnell and Carter Gunn
This movie titled ‘Colony’, directed by Ross McDonnell and Carter Gunn, documents a time of crisis in beekeeping world. The Colony Collapse Disorder has left landscapes of empty beehives all across America, threatening the beekeeping industry and our honey supply. Colony captures the str
